All of a sudden Omnisphere won't load most of the patches. Says it can't find the Soundsources, which look like they are all still right where they've always been. Tried calling Spectrsonics support and missed their return call. "The Googles" are failing me miserably.
Has anyone ever run into this issue. How did you solve it? I really need to get this working again. Should I just re-install??

I've never run into this. If the plug-in and STEAM folder reside on different drives (as would usually be the case) it's possible that the shortcut/alias linking the two got corrupted. Maybe delete that and create a new one? You could also try re-installing just the plug-in (not the library) which would take little time and might fix the problem. Or "repair permissions"? I'm not on Mac but that's the first thing all of my Mac buddies do whenever anything goes screwy...

Spectrasonics has a procedure for putting the "STEAM" folder on another drive which involves creating an alias for it and putting that alias in a certain folder in one of the Library/Application Support folders (top level or user level, can't remember). The thing is you have to remove the word "alias" or it won't work.
Do a search for STEAM and find the original and the alias, trash the alias and create a new one and put it in the correct Application Support folder.
If that doesn't work, repairing permissions is a good idea, maybe start there anyway.

Thanks guys, I tried all of that and still nothing. I bit the bullet and just fed CD's into my system for the past three hours. Good news is that Omnisphere is working again. 
The bad news was that it took three hours of feeding CD's into my system.
